14.01.2014 Aufrufe

IBM Cognos Business Intelligence Version 10.2.1.1: Verwaltung und ...

IBM Cognos Business Intelligence Version 10.2.1.1: Verwaltung und ...

IBM Cognos Business Intelligence Version 10.2.1.1: Verwaltung und ...

MEHR ANZEIGEN
WENIGER ANZEIGEN

Erfolgreiche ePaper selbst erstellen

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.

In einem solchen Fall erstellen Sie mithilfe von <strong>IBM</strong> <strong>Cognos</strong> Software Development<br />

Kit eine benutzerdefinierte Java-Klasse <strong>und</strong> geben ihren Namen während der BI-<br />

Konfiguration an. Legen Sie in diesem Szenario die Eigenschaft Tenant-ID-Zuordnung,<br />

Providerklasse in <strong>IBM</strong> <strong>Cognos</strong> Configuration wie folgt fest:<br />

custom_class_name<br />

Hierbei steht custom_class_name für den Namen der benutzerdefinierten Klasse. Beispiel:<br />

com.example.Class.<br />

<strong>IBM</strong> <strong>Cognos</strong> Software Development Kit enthält eine benutzerdefinierte Beispielklasse<br />

zum Ermitteln von Tenantinformationen. Die Beispieldateien befinden sich<br />

im Verzeichnis c10_Position\sdk\java\AuthenticationProvider\<br />

MultiTenancyTenantProviderSample.<br />

Aktivieren der Multi-Tenant-Funktionalität<br />

Zum Aktivieren der <strong>IBM</strong> <strong>Cognos</strong>-Multi-Tenant-Funktionalität müssen Sie die erweiterten<br />

Authentifizierungseigenschaften auf allen Computern festlegen, auf denen<br />

Content Manager konfiguriert ist; anschließend müssen Sie den <strong>IBM</strong> <strong>Cognos</strong>-<br />

Service erneut starten.<br />

Vorbereitende Schritte<br />

v Ermitteln Sie, wie Tenantinformationen für einzelne Benutzer in Ihrer Umgebung<br />

festgelegt werden. Weitere Informationen finden Sie in „Ermitteln von<br />

Tenantinformationen” auf Seite 456.<br />

v Kompilieren Sie alle erforderlichen benutzerdefinierten Java-Klassendateien als<br />

JAR-Dateien, <strong>und</strong> speichern Sie sie entweder gemeinsam mit allen zugehörigen<br />

Dateien im Verzeichnis c10_Position/webapps/p2pd/WEB-INF/lib oder aktualisieren<br />

Sie die Umgebungsvariable CLASSPATH so, dass sie den Pfad zu diesen Dateien<br />

enthält. Dies ist nur erforderlich, wenn ein angepasster Java-Authentifizierungsprovider<br />

verwendet wird.<br />

v Bestimmen Sie, ob Sie die Multi-Tenant-Einstellungen auf alle konfigurierten Namespaces<br />

oder auf einzelne Namespaces anwenden müssen. Multi-Tenant-Eigenschaften<br />

für einen spezifischen Namespace überschreiben alle global festgelegten<br />

Multi-Tenant-Eigenschaften. Wenn ein Namespace nicht für die Verwendung der<br />

Multi-Tenant-Funktionalität konfiguriert ist, wird mithilfe von Richtlinien <strong>und</strong><br />

Berechtigungen für Objekte festgelegt, wer Zugriff auf diese Objekte hat. Wenn<br />

die Multi-Tenant-Funktionalität in mehreren Namespaces ausgeführt wird, müssen<br />

die Tenant-IDs in allen Namespaces eindeutig sein.<br />

Vorgehensweise<br />

1. Öffnen Sie <strong>IBM</strong> <strong>Cognos</strong> Configuration.<br />

2. Wählen Sie aus, ob Sie die Einstellungen für die Multi-Tenant-Funktionalität<br />

global für alle Namespaces oder für einen bestimmten Namespace konfigurieren<br />

möchten.<br />

v Wenn Sie die Multi-Tenant-Funktionalität für alle Namespaces konfigurieren<br />

möchten, klicken Sie im Explorerfenster für die Kategorie Sicherheit auf<br />

Authentifizierung.<br />

v Wenn Sie die Multi-Tenant-Funktionalität für einen Namespace konfigurieren<br />

möchten, klicken Sie im Explorerfenster für die Kategorie Sicherheit auf<br />

Authentifizierung. Klicken Sie anschließend auf den Namespace, den Sie<br />

konfigurieren möchten.<br />

3. Klicken Sie unter Multi-Tenant-Funktionalität für die Eigenschaft Tenant-ID-<br />

Zuordnung auf die Schaltfläche 'Bearbeiten'.<br />

458 <strong>IBM</strong> <strong>Cognos</strong> <strong>Business</strong> <strong>Intelligence</strong> <strong>Version</strong> <strong>10.2.1.1</strong>: <strong>Verwaltung</strong> <strong>und</strong> Sicherheit

Hurra! Ihre Datei wurde hochgeladen und ist bereit für die Veröffentlichung.

Erfolgreich gespeichert!

Leider ist etwas schief gelaufen!